Ok, as i said before. A track is being built in Tobago the man is a God sent, buttt...A few things have been over looked, such as it is going to be quite costly, $350 ferry fee, racing gas, Tobogo's food prices are higher, accomodations, and not to mention the man indicated to me that his track is for everyone, so promotors will be used, fact is they are already planing for you, and now we come to regestation fees the track would be rented with full works. before you even launch at the light $1000.

Well guys, work has stopped on the track for about 5 months now. This is to allow the earth to settle. Two mountains were cut down and two ditches were filled, so we need time to allow the soil to settle naturally. Work should resume by November into March. April should see a basic track down and then to complete infrastructure
